ING, Australia's most recommended bank for 5 consecutive years, is looking for an experienced **Finance Data and Systems Analyst** to join its high performing **Financial Control** team.

Reporting to the Senior Financial Controller, as our **Finance Data and Systems Analyst** you'll own business processes and services in relation to Finance Systems Management and Data Architecture, Process & Testing, Project Management and Process Improvement.

This key role provides first line functional activity to users in addressing **system performance, availability, data quality and user access issues** while also acting as a conduit with the global support team to assist in resolving more complex issues, and for the execution of **change requests**. Additionally, the role will **facilitate driving process improvements** across the Finance function.

Ideally, we're looking for someone with **PeopleSoft or Oracle skills** with **SQL and Coding skills**, or at the very least have a genuine desire to learn on the job. You'll be an automation specialist and thrive in automating excel processes through SQL workflow and have a passion for continuous improvement. Other strengths that will be looked upon favorably include Financial, Statistical and Mathematical strengths, and importantly, an enthusiasm for working within the Financial Technical sector.

You'll be working on data extraction & enrichment of the data pipeline, from the data warehouse, treasury management system, various source systems and other references. Over time, with increased experience, you'll help us to identify opportunities to drive automation and digitisation of the existing processes and enhance controls within the finance department.

**What you'll do**
- Ensure the ongoing effectiveness of the required infrastructure across data, processes, and systems to ensure the integrity and efficiency of the bank's accounting, payments, closing and reporting across the wider Finance function
- Own and implement functional training for Finance system users using PeopleSoft
- Support the team on finance systems projects and ad-hoc requests including the development of financial reports
- Co-ordinate and execute acceptance testing
- Deliver finance project management including ongoing engagement with our technology and global teams
- Document business requirements, systems architecture and processes
- Monitor data and processes to ensure the integrity and efficiency of Finance outputs
- Manage the Accounts Payable and General Ledger, including maintenance of accounts, cost centres etc.
- Act as the first point of contact for users regarding PeopleSoft
- Developing and maintaining Business Objects Reports

**What we're looking for**
- Extensive experience in developing test plan and test scripts with experience with end to end functional testing activities
- Highly analytic, problem solving, lateral thinking & interpretive skills with strong attention to detail
- SQL/VBA or other programming experience (nice to have)
- Proficient working knowledge in RDBMS (SQL, PL/SQL): programming proficiency in PeopleCode, SQR, Application Engine and Application Packages
- Excellent report writing skills with proven experience working with the Agile Ways of Working
- A desire to learn & succeed with a positive and proactive 'can-do' attitude who has the ability
- Ability to balance deadlines, priorities & work on concurrent tasks with good interpersonal & relationship building skills.
